//verifica a quantidade de garrafas máxima da embalagem
function verQtde(){
		var soma=0.00;
		var i=1;
		while(1){
			qtde = document.getElementById('garrafa'+i);
			if(qtde!=null){
				soma = soma + 1*qtde.value;
				i++;
			}else{
            	break;
			}
		}

		if(qtde_garrafas==soma){
			return true;
		}else{
			alert('A quantidade de garrafas deve ser igual a '+qtde_garrafas +'(Quantidade:'+soma+')');
			return false;
		}
}

//veficoa pedido mínimo

function verPedidoMinimo(){
	var qtde = document.getElementById('quantidade');
	var personalizado = document.getElementById('personalizavel');
	if(personalizado!=null){
		if(personalizado.checked==true){
			minimo = pqtdemin;
		}else{
			minimo = qtdemin;	
		}
	}else{
		minimo = qtdemin;	
	}
	if(qtde.value>=minimo){
		return true;
	}else{
		alert('Você deve pedir ao menos '+minimo+' unidades dessa embalagem(Quantidade Atual: '+qtde.value+' Unidade(s))');
		qtde.focus();
		return false;
	}
}

function adiciona(frm){
	if(frm.composicao.value=="CHOOSE_BOTTLE_QTDE"){
		if(!verQtde()){
			return false;
		}
	}
	if(frm.quantidade.value==""){
		alert('Informe a quantidade');
		frm.quantidade.focus();
		return false;
	}else{
		if(frm.quantidade.value > 0){
			return verPedidoMinimo();
		}else{
			alert('A quantidade de embalagens não pode ser igual a zero');
			frm.quantidade.focus();
			return false;
		}
	}
}

function validaPedidoDadosSite(frm){
	if(frm.nome.value==""){
		alert('Informe seu nome');
		frm.nome.focus();
		return false;
	}else if(!eval_mail(frm.email.value)){
		alert('Email Inválido ou não informado. Por favor verifique');
		frm.email.value='';
		frm.email.focus();
		return false;
	}else if(frm.endereco.value==""){
		alert('Informe o endereço de entrega');
		frm.endereco.focus();
		return false;
	}else if(frm.cep.value==""){
		alert('Informe o CEP');
		frm.cep.focus();
		return false;
	}else if(frm.cidade.value==""){
		alert('Informe a Cidade');
		frm.cidade.focus();
		return false;
	}else if(frm.estado.value==""){
		alert('Informe o Estado');
		frm.estado.focus();
		return false;
	}else{
		if(frm.telefone_numero.value!=""){
			//o telefone tah preenchido, verificando o ddd
			if(frm.telefone_ddd.value!=""){
				return true;
			}else{
				alert('o preenchimento do telefone requer o preenchimento do ddd');
				frm.telefone_ddd.focus();
				return false;
			}
		}else if(frm.telefone_ddd.value!=""){
			//igual ao de cima, só que na ordem inversa
			if(frm.telefone_numero.value!=""){
				return true;
			}else{
				alert('o preenchimento do ddd requer o preenchimento do telefone');
				frm.telefone_numero.focus();
				return false;
			}
		}
	}
}

function validaContato(frm){
	if(frm.nome.value.lenght<3){
		alert('Informe seu nome');
		frm.nome.focus();
		return false;
	}else if(!eval_mail(frm.email.value)){
		alert('Email Inválido ou não informado. Por favor verifique');
		frm.email.value='';
		frm.email.focus();
		return false;
	}else if(frm.obs.value.lenght<1){
		alert('Informe sua mensagem');
		frm.obs.focus();
		return false;
	}else{
		return true;
	}
}